From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from cuda.sgi.com (cuda2.sgi.com [192.48.176.25]) by oss.sgi.com (8.14.3/8.14.3/SuSE Linux 0.8) with ESMTP id p1KLBWeg104865 for ; Sun, 20 Feb 2011 15:11:33 -0600 Received: from ipmail04.adl6.internode.on.net (localhost [127.0.0.1]) by cuda.sgi.com (Spam Firewall) with ESMTP id 96AA02EC1EE for ; Sun, 20 Feb 2011 13:14:13 -0800 (PST) Received: from ipmail04.adl6.internode.on.net (ipmail04.adl6.internode.on.net [150.101.137.141]) by cuda.sgi.com with ESMTP id iIXEA40twPumEbhv for ; Sun, 20 Feb 2011 13:14:13 -0800 (PST) Date: Mon, 21 Feb 2011 08:14:10 +1100 From: Dave Chinner Subject: Re: External log size limitations Message-ID: <20110220211410.GA3166@dastard> References: <4D5C1D77.1060000@spinpro.com> <20110217003233.GH13052@dastard> <4D5E8FAD.9080802@spinpro.com> MIME-Version: 1.0 Content-Disposition: inline In-Reply-To: <4D5E8FAD.9080802@spinpro.com> List-Id: XFS Filesystem from SGI List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: xfs-bounces@oss.sgi.com Errors-To: xfs-bounces@oss.sgi.com To: Andrew Klaassen Cc: xfs@oss.sgi.com T24gRnJpLCBGZWIgMTgsIDIwMTEgYXQgMTA6MjY6MzdBTSAtMDUwMCwgQW5kcmV3IEtsYWFzc2Vu IHdyb3RlOgo+IERhdmUgQ2hpbm5lciB3cm90ZToKPiA+VGhlIGxpbWl0IGlzIGp1c3QgdW5kZXIg MkdCIG5vdyAtIHRoYXQgZG9jdW1lbnQgaXMgYSBjb3VwbGUgb2YgeWVhcnMKPiA+b3V0IG9mIGRh dGUgLSBzbyBpZiB5b3UgYXJlIHJ1bm5pbmcgb24gYW55dGhpbmcgbW9yZSByZWNlbnQgdGhhdCBh Cj4gPn4yLjYuMjcga2VybmVsIDJHQiBsb2dzIHNob3VsZCB3b3JrIGZpbmUuCj4gCj4gQWgsIGdv b2QgdG8ga25vdy4KPiAKPiA+RGF0YSB3cml0ZSBzcGVlZCBvciBtZXRhZGF0YSB3cml0ZSBzcGVl ZD8gV2hhdCBzb3J0IG9mIHdyaXRlCj4gPnBhdHRlcm5zPwo+IAo+IEEgY291cGxlIG9mIGh1bmRy ZWQgbm9kZXMgb24gYSByZW5kZXJmYXJtIGRvaW5nIG1vc3RseSBjb21wb3NpdGluZwo+IHdpdGgg c29tZSAzRC4gIEl0J3MgYWJvdXQgODAvMjAgcmVhZC93cml0ZS4gIE9uIHRoZSBjdXJyZW50IHN5 c3RlbQo+IHRoYXQgd2UncmUgdGhpbmtpbmcgb2YgY29udmVydGluZyAtIGFuIEV4YXN0b3JlIHZl cnNpb24gMyBzeXN0ZW0gLQo+IGJyb3dzaW5nIHRoZSBmaWxlc3lzdGVtIGJlY29tZXMgcmlkaWN1 bG91c2x5IHNsb3cgd2hlbiB3cml0ZSBsb2Fkcwo+IGJlY29tZSBtb2RlcmF0ZSwgd2hpY2ggaXMg d2h5IHNuYXBwaWVyIG1ldGFkYXRhIG9wZXJhdGlvbnMgYXJlCj4gYXR0cmFjdGl2ZSB0byB1cy4K Ck9LLCBidXQgSSBkb24ndCB0aGluayB0aGF0IHRoZSBtZXRhZGF0YSBvcGVyYXRpb25zIGFyZSBi ZWNvbWluZyBzbG93CmJlY2F1c2UgeW91IGFyZSBkb2luZyB3cml0ZSBvcGVyYXRpb25zIC0gdGhl eSBhcmUgbGlrZWx5IHRvIGJlIHNsb3cKZHVlIHRvIGRvaW5nIF9sb3RzIG9mIElPXy4gVGhhdCB3 b24ndCBjaGFuZ2Ugd2l0aCBYRlMuLi4uCgo+IE9uZSB0aGluZyBJJ20gd29ycmllZCBhYm91dCwg dGhvdWdoLCBpcyBtb3ZpbmcgZnJvbSB0aGUgRXhhc3RvcmUncwo+IDY0SyBibG9jayBzaXplIHRv IHRoZSA0SyBMaW51eCBibG9ja3NpemUgbGltaXRhdGlvbi4gIE15IHF1aWNrCj4gY2FsY3VsYXRp b24gc2F5cyB0aGF0IHRoYXQncyBnb2luZyB0byByZWR1Y2Ugb3VyIHRocm91Z2hwdXQgdW5kZXIK PiByYW5kb20gbG9hZCAod2hpY2ggaXMgd2hhdCBhIHJlbmRlcmZhcm0gYmVjb21lcyB3aXRoIGEg Y291cGxlIG9mCj4gaHVuZHJlZCBub2RlcykgZnJvbSBhYm91dCAyMDBNQi9zIHRvIGFib3V0IDEz TUIvcyB3aXRoIG91cgo+IDU2eDcyMDBycG0gZGlza3MuICBJdCdzIHRvbyBiYWQgdGhvc2UgbGFy Z2UgYmxvY2tzaXplIHBhdGNoZXMgZnJvbSBhCj4gY291cGxlIG9mIHllYXJzIGJhY2sgZGlkbid0 IGdvIHRocm91Z2ggdG8gbWFrZSB0aGlzIHdvcnJ5IG1vb3QuCgpIb3cgbXVjaCBkYXRhIGlzIGFj dHVhbGx5IGJlaW5nIGNoYW5nZWQgb3V0IG9mIGVhY2ggb2YgdGhvc2UgNjRrCmJsb2Nrcz8gTGFz dCB0aW1lIEkgYW5hbHlzZWQgYSBjb21wb3NpdGluZyBhcHBsaWNhdGlvbiwgaXQgd2FzCnJlYWRp bmcgZnVsbCBmcmFtZXMgYW5kIHRleHR1cmVzLCB0aGVuIHdyaXRpbmcgb25seSB0aGUgbW9kaWZp ZWQKcG9ydGlvbnMgb2YgdGhlIGZyYW1lcyBiYWNrIHRvIHRoZSBzZXJ2ZXIuIEJlY2F1c2UgdGhl c2Ugd2VyZSDRlW1hbGwKc2VjdGlvbnMgb2YgdGhlIGZyYW1lcywgaXQgd2FzIHR5cGljYWxseSB3 cml0aW5nIG9ubHkgYSBmZXcgS0IgYXQgYQp0aW1lIHBlciBJTywgd2l0aCBzZXZlcmFsIHdyaXRl IElPcyBhbmQgc2Vla3MgZm9yIGVhY2ggcmVnaW9uIGl0IHdhcwp3b3JraW5nIG9uLiBJdCB3YXMg Y29tcGxldGVseSBzbWFsbCByYW5kb20gd3JpdGUgYm91bmQsIGFuZCB3aGlsZQpYRlMgZG9lcyBP SyBhdCB0aGF0IHNvcnQgb2Ygd29ya2xvYWQsIGl0J3Mgbm90IG9wdG1pc2VkIGZvciBpdCBsaWtl CldBRkwsIFpGUyBvciBCVFJGUy4uLgoKSU9XcyB0aGUgd3JpdGUgYmFuZHdpZHRoIG9mIFhGUyB3 aWxsIGJlIGRldGVybWluZWQgYnkgaG93IGJpZyB0aGVzZQpJT3MgYXJlLCBub3QgdGhlIGJsb2Nr IHNpemUuIEl0IG1heSBiZSBmYXN0ZXIgZG9pbmcgc21hbGxlciBJT3MKYmVjYXVzZSB0aGUgNjRr IGJsb2NrIHNpemUgd291bGQgcHJvYmFibHkgcmVxdWlyZSByZWFkLW1vZGlmeS13cml0ZQpjeWNs ZXMgZm9yIHRoaXMgd29ya2xvYWQuIFhGUyB3aWxsIHN0aWxsIG1heCBvdXQgdGhlIGRpc2sgSU9Q UyB1bmRlcgp0aGlzIHdvcmtsb2FkLCBzbyBkb24ndCBleHBlY3QgY29sZC1jYWNoZSBtZXRhZGF0 YSBvcGVyYXRpb25zIHRvIGJlCm1pcmFjdWxvdXNseSBmYXN0ZXIgdGhhbiBvbiB5b3VyIGN1cnJl bnQgc3lzdGVtLi4uCgo+ID5BcyBpdCBpcywgMkdCIGlzIHN0aWxsIG5vdCBlbm91Z2ggZm9yIHBy ZXZlbnRpbmcgbWV0YWRhdGEgd3JpdGViYWNrCj4gPmZvciBtaW51dGVzIGlmIHRoYXQgaXMgd2hh dCB5b3UgYXJlIHRyeWluZyB0byBkby4gIEV2ZW4gaWYgeW91IHVzZQo+ID50aGUgbmV3IGRlbGF5 bG9nIG1vdW50IG9wdGlvbiAtIHdoaWNoIHJlZHVjZXMgbG9nIHRyYWZmaWMgYnkgYW4KPiA+b3Jk ZXIgb2YgbWFnbml0dWRlIGZvciBtb3N0IG5vbi1zeW5jaHJvbm91cyB3b3JrbG9hZHMgLSBsb2cg d3JpdGUKPiA+cmF0ZXMgY2FuIGJlIHVwd2FyZHMgb2YgMzBNQi9zIHVuZGVyIGNvbmN1cnJlbnQg bWV0YWRhdGEgaW50ZW5zaXZlCj4gPndvcmtsb2Fkcy4uLi4KPiAKPiBJcyB0aGVyZSBhIHJ1bGUt b2YtdGh1bWIgdG8gY29udmVydCBudW1iZXIgb2YgZmlsZXMgYmVpbmcgd3JpdHRlbiB0bwo+IGxv ZyB3cml0ZSByYXRlcz8gIFdlIHB1c2ggYSBsb3Qgb2YgZGF0YSB0aHJvdWdoLCBidXQgbW9zdCBv ZiB0aGUKPiBmaWxlcyBhcmUgYSBmZXcgbWVnYWJ5dGVzIGluIHNpemUgaW5zdGVhZCBvZiBhIGZl dyBraWxvYnl0ZXMuCgpOb3QgcmVhbGx5LiBSdW4geW91ciB3b3JrbG9hZCBhbmQgbWVhc3VyZSBp dCAtIFhGUyBleHBvcnRzIHN0YXRzCnRoYXQgaW5jbHVkZSB0aGUgYW1vdW50IHdyaXR0ZW4gdG8g dGhlIGpvdXJuYWwuIFNlZToKCmh0dHA6Ly94ZnMub3JnL2luZGV4LnBocC9SdW50aW1lX1N0YXRz Cgo+ID4gZmlsbGluZyBhIDJHQiBsb2cgbWVhbnMgeW91J2xsCj4gPnByb2JhYmx5IGhhdmUgdGVu IG9mIGdpZ2FieXRlcyBvZiBkaXJ0eSBtZXRhZGF0YSBpbiBtZW1vcnksIHNvCj4gPnJlc3BvbnNl IHRvIG1lbW9yeSBzaG9ydGFnZXMgY2FuIGNhdXNlIElPIHN0b3JtcyBhbmQgc2V2ZXJlCj4gPmlu dGVyYWN0aXZpdHkgcHJvYmxlbXMsIGV0Yy4KPiAKPiBJIGFzc3VtZSB0aGF0IGlmIHdlIHBhY2tl ZCB0aGUgc2VydmVyIHdpdGggMTI4R0Igb2YgUkFNIHdlIHdvdWxkbid0Cj4gaGF2ZSB0byB3b3Jy eSBhYm91dCB0aGF0IGFzIG11Y2guICBCdXQuLi4gc2hvcnQgb2YgdGhhdCwgd291bGQgeW91Cj4g aGF2ZSBhIHJ1bGUgb2YgdGh1bWIgZm9yIGxvZyBzaXplIHRvIG1lbW9yeSBzaXplPyAgQ291bGQg SSBleHBlY3QKPiByZWFzb25hYmxlIHBlcmZvcm1hbmNlIHdpdGggYSAyR0IgbG9nIGFuZCAzMkdC IGluIHRoZSBzZXJ2ZXI/ICBXaXRoCj4gMTJHQiBpbiB0aGUgc2VydmVyPwoKPHNocnVnPgoKSXQn cyBhbGwgZGVwZW5kZW50IG9uIHlvdXIgd29ya2xvYWQuIFRlc3QgaXQgYW5kIHNlZS4uLgoKPiBJ IGtub3cgeW91J2QgaGF2ZSB0byBtb3N0bHkgZ3Vlc3MgdG8gbWFrZSB1cCBhIHJ1bGUgb2YgdGh1 bWIsIGJ1dAo+IHlvdXIgZ3Vlc3NlcyB3b3VsZCBiZSBhIGxvdCBiZXR0ZXIgdGhhbiBtaW5lLiAg Oi0pCj4gCj4gPkluIGdlbmVyYWwsIEknbSBmaW5kaW5nIHRoYXQgYSBsb2cgc2l6ZSBvZiBhcm91 bmQgNTEyTUIgdy8gZGVsYXlsb2cKPiA+Z2l2ZXMgdGhlIGJlc3QgdHJhZGVvZmYgYmV0d2VlbiBz Y2FsYWJpbGl0eSwgcGVyZm9ybWFuY2UsIG1lbW9yeQo+ID51c2FnZSBhbmQgcmVsYXRpdmVseSBz YW5lIHJlY292ZXJ5IHRpbWVzLi4uCj4gCj4gSSdtIGV4Y2l0ZWQgYWJvdXQgdGhlIGRlbGF5bG9n IGFuZCBvdGhlciBpbXByb3ZlbWVudHMgSSdtIHNlZWluZwo+IGVudGVyaW5nIHRoZSBrZXJuZWws IGJ1dCBJJ20gd29ycmllZCBhYm91dCBzdGFiaWxpdHkuICBUaGVyZSBzZWVtIHRvCj4gaGF2ZSBi ZWVuIGEgbG90IG9mIGJ1Z2ZpeCBwYXRjaGVzIGFuZCBwYW5pYyByZXBvcnRzIHNpbmNlIDIuNi4z NSBmb3IKPiBYRlMgdG8gZ28gYWxvbmcgd2l0aCB0aGUgcGVyZm9ybWFuY2UgaW1wcm92ZW1lbnRz LCB3aGljaCBtYWtlcyBtZQo+IHRlbXB0ZWQgdG8gc3RpY2sgdG8gMi42LjM0IHVudGlsIHRoZSBk dXN0IHNldHRsZXMgYW5kIHRoZSBraW5rcyBhcmUKPiB3b3JrZWQgb3V0LiAgSWYgSSBwdXQgdGhl IG5ldyBYRlMgY29kZSBvbiB0aGUgc2VydmVyLCB3aWxsIGl0IHN0YXkKPiB1cCBmb3IgYSB5ZWFy IG9yIG1vcmUgd2l0aG91dCBhbnkgcGFuaWNzIG9yIGNyYXNoZXM/CgpJZiB5b3UgYXJlIGNvbmNl cm5lZCBhYm91dCBzdGFiaWxpdHkgdW5kZXIgaGVhdnkgbG9hZCBpbiBwcm9kdWN0aW9uCmVudmly b25tZW50cywgdGhlbiB5b3Ugc2hvdWxkIGJlIHJ1bm5pbmcgYSB3ZWxsIHRlc3RlZCBlbnZpcm9u bWVudApzdWNoIGFzIFJIRUwgb3IgU0xFUy4gVGhlIGxhdGVzdCBhbmQgZ3JlYXRlc3QgbWFpbmxp bmUga2VybmVsIGlzIG5vdApmb3IgeW91Li4uLgoKQ2hlZXJzLAoKRGF2ZS4KLS0gCkRhdmUgQ2hp bm5lcgpkYXZpZEBmcm9tb3JiaXQuY29tC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fXwp4ZnMgbWFpbGluZyBsaXN0Cnhmc0Bvc3Muc2dpLmNvbQpodHRwOi8v b3NzLnNnaS5jb20vbWFpbG1hbi9saXN0aW5mby94ZnMK